Transaction e790669943726abaf98ae9b37ea12109abe74913225118a37e9612fd9539e759

1 Input
2 Outputs
  • e790669943726abaf98ae9b37ea12109abe74913225118a37e9612fd9539e759:0
  • value  48896
    address  3FiaJGVXks1LgjmmxVPNgv92tEULmb6Xby
  • e790669943726abaf98ae9b37ea12109abe74913225118a37e9612fd9539e759:1
  • value  2100000
    address  12tQbedVTPsNy7gmEbGM98XTxRZ7RXYdQV